25 import "vnet/interface_types.api";
26 import "vnet/fib/fib_types.api";
27 import "vnet/ethernet/ethernet_types.api";
28 import "vnet/mfib/mfib_types.api";
29 import "vnet/interface_types.api";
52 autoreply define ip_table_add_del
56 bool is_add [
default=
true];
88 autoreply define ip_table_replace_begin
103 autoreply define ip_table_replace_end
116 autoreply define ip_table_flush
127 manual_endian manual_print define ip_table_details
158 define ip_route_add_del
162 bool is_add [
default=
true];
166 define ip_route_add_del_reply
187 manual_endian manual_print define ip_route_details
199 define ip_route_lookup
212 define ip_route_lookup_reply
232 autoreply define set_ip_flow_hash
253 autoreply define sw_interface_ip6_enable_disable
264 define ip_mtable_dump
269 define ip_mtable_details
314 define ip_mroute_add_del
318 bool is_add [
default=
true];
322 define ip_mroute_add_del_reply
332 define ip_mroute_dump
342 manual_endian manual_print define ip_mroute_details
348 define ip_address_details
355 define ip_address_dump
367 define ip_unnumbered_details
377 define ip_unnumbered_dump
398 define mfib_signal_dump
404 define mfib_signal_details
411 u8 ip_packet_data[256];
421 autoreply define ip_punt_police
426 bool is_add [
default=
true];
440 vl_api_interface_index_t rx_sw_if_index;
456 bool is_add [
default=
true];
459 define ip_punt_redirect_dump
467 define ip_punt_redirect_details
473 autoreply define ip_container_proxy_add_del
479 bool is_add [
default=
true];
482 define ip_container_proxy_dump
488 define ip_container_proxy_details
507 autoreply define ip_source_and_port_range_check_add_del
511 bool is_add [
default=
true];
526 autoreply define ip_source_and_port_range_check_interface_add_del
530 bool is_add [
default=
true];
544 autoreply define sw_interface_ip6_set_link_local_address
549 vl_api_ip6_address_t
ip;
559 autoreply define ioam_enable
576 autoreply define ioam_disable
589 autoreply define ip_reassembly_set
601 define ip_reassembly_get
609 define ip_reassembly_get_reply
627 autoreply define ip_reassembly_enable_disable
vl_api_ip_reass_type_t type
vl_api_punt_redirect_t punt
vl_api_ip_reass_type_t type
typedef ip_route
An IP route.
typedef ip_table
An IP table.
vl_api_interface_index_t sw_if_index
vl_api_interface_index_t sw_if_index
vl_api_interface_index_t sw_if_index
vl_api_interface_index_t sw_if_index
vl_api_interface_index_t sw_if_index
vl_api_address_with_prefix_t prefix
typedef punt_redirect
Punt redirect type.
vl_api_interface_index_t sw_if_index
vl_api_interface_index_t sw_if_index
u32 max_reassembly_length
vl_api_interface_index_t sw_if_index
u32 expire_walk_interval_ms
u32 max_reassembly_length
vl_api_fib_path_t paths[n_paths]
vl_api_interface_index_t sw_if_index
vl_api_interface_index_t tx_sw_if_index
vl_api_interface_index_t ip_sw_if_index
static uword ip_punt_redirect(vlib_main_t *vm, vlib_node_runtime_t *node, vlib_frame_t *frame, u8 arc_index, fib_protocol_t fproto)
vl_api_punt_redirect_t punt
vl_api_interface_index_t sw_if_index
typedef ip_mroute
Add / del route request.
vl_api_ip_reass_type_t type
vl_api_interface_index_t sw_if_index
u32 expire_walk_interval_ms
vl_api_interface_index_t sw_if_index
vl_api_interface_index_t sw_if_index